24-year-old Ben Howie yet to serve his first customers in Pateley Bridge attraction owing to lockdown
A 24-year-old entrepreneur in the Yorkshire Dales is gearing up to reopen the doors of the world's oldest sweet shop after becoming the new owner.
Ben Howie has taken over the Oldest Sweet Shop in the World, a Guinness World Record-holding tourist attraction in Pateley Bridge, but is yet to scoop a single pound of pear drops at the counter because of lockdown restrictions.
